Latest Patents
One of Pulvermacher's latest patents is a wireless, proximity-based security system designed for securing or tracking valuable objects. This system includes a base station and multiple security fobs that are tracked via an ultra-wideband transceiver relative to an outer perimeter. An audible alarm is triggered when a security fob is detected beyond this perimeter, while a haptic alarm activates when it crosses a sub-perimeter. Another significant patent is for a high-density electrical connector that facilitates connections for plural multi-contact linear arrays with an electrical system. This invention features a base portion with an alignment member to hold the arrays in place, an interconnect portion with multiple pins for contact, and closure elements to secure the components together.
